/* Start of CMSMS style sheet 'main menu' */
#mainMenu {
position: relative;
}

#mainSearchMenu div.label {
display: block;
float: left;
}

input#submit {
margin-top: 18px;
}

#mainSearchMenu label {
display: block;
}

#mainMenu ul {
height: 25px;
}

#mainMenu ul li {
display: block;
float: left;
}

#mainMenu ul li a {
width: 110px;
margin-left: 5px;
display: inline;
float: left;
background-color: #458C1A;
background-image: url('images/mainMenu-bg.gif');
background-repeat: no-repeat;
background-position: top;
text-align: center;
text-decoration: none;
color: #fff;
height: 25px;
line-height: 24px;
}

#mainMenu ul li a:hover {
background-position: bottom;
color: #fff;
}

#mainMenu ul li.currentpage a {
/* background-position: bottom; */
background-color: #000;
background-image: none;
color: #fff;
}

#mainMenu ul li#firstitem a {
color: #fff;
}

#mainMenu ul li#firstitem a {
/* background-image: none;
background-color: transparent;
width: 100px */
}

#mainMenu ul li#firstitem a:hover {
color: #fff;
}
/* End of 'main menu' */

